Sample the best of the lagoon with fritto misto. Fritto misto di mare (fried mixed seafood) is one of the most popular dishes in Venice. Usually served as a platter for two or more, this dish consists of all kinds of fish and seafood, lightly battered and fried to perfection. 6. Group Size: Max 12. From €99 From €69. Book a Private Tour.Mar 4, 2024 · In Venice, ‘scartosso de pesse frito’ (fried fish packet) has been served since the 1600s. Its name comes from the typical cone-shaped paper that contains the fried mix that will tantalize your taste buds. The most common fried mix is squid and shrimps, very often served with a slice of roasted polenta or with battered vegetables.

Traditionally in Venice, pasta e fagioli is linked to the annual slaughter of the pig. Pasta fagioli used to be made using cheap cuts of the pork such as lard, pancetta, rind, and sometimes even trotters. It is a dish popular more in winter, when the temperatures drop and all you want is a warming up, hearty dish.Italy, known for its rich history, stunning landscapes, and delicious cuisine, is a dream destination for many travelers. Walking through the streets of Venice, it is easy to come across small typical taverns called “bàcari”. The specialty of these places are cicchetti (shots), the most famous street food in the city which consists of small slices of bread or croutons, stuffed in several ways: creamed cod, cuttlefish, vegetables, mozzarella or meatballs of ...
